With state revenues projected to come in lower than Governor’s Pritzker’s proposed budget, some in Springfield are advocating for tax increases to fund additional governmental spending. Some of the ideas being talked about include a service tax, a delivery tax, and an advertisement tax.

Many legislators from both parties are hesitant to raise taxes once again and no concrete tax-increase proposals have yet been filed.
